How does the new Coke contract impact contract with food vendors like Panda Express? Panda is a Pepsi serving restaurant. Does this mean the in park Panda Express has to serve Coke or would they still have Pepsi since that is who their contract is with?

Link to comment
Share on other sites

^^^I'd imagine it just depends on the operating agreement with Panda Express. The Panda Express in CityWalk at Universal Orlando serves Pepsi in an otherwise Coke-filled resort. The location is a part of a food court with the Whopper Bar and Moe's, both of which serve Coke products despite Panda Express still serving Pepsi.
